Technology Services maintains and supports the following at all Drury campuses:

  • Campus WiFi and wired networks (non-residential)
  • All servers and network hardware
  • Telephones and the Cisco network
  • Application software such as MyDrury and EX
  • Computers provided to staff and faculty
  • Computers in labs on campus sites
